Conscious Relationship Choices
Relationships are dynamic and should evolve with the individuals involved, allowing for conscious choices rather than defaulting to traditional norms. Both monogamy and polyamory can benefit from intentional discussions about desires and boundaries, ultimately enhancing intimacy and satisfaction. Embracing the freedom to choose fosters deeper connections, regardless of the relationship structure.In this clip
